Plastic Omnium is a world-leading provider of innovative solutions for a unique, safer and more sustainable mobility experience. Innovation-driven since its creation, the Group develops and produces intelligent exterior systems, customized complex modules, lighting systems, clean energy systems and electrification solutions for all mobility companies. With a €9.5 billion economic revenue in 2022, a global network of 150 plants and 43 R&D centers, Plastic Omnium relies on its 40,500 employees to meet the challenges of transforming mobility.
Plastic Omnium Module division develops, assembles and delivers complex, just-in-sequence modules for mass production. World leader, HBPO, now 100% Plastic Omnium, specializes in highly integrated modules, including front-end & cockpit modules, center consoles and charge lid modules. Through new BEVs architectures, it constantly develops new modules with customized solutions.
